How much is a round-trip flight from Taipei City to Los Angeles?

This analysis is based on the cheapest round-trip price found on KAYAK in the last 12 months by searching for a flight from Taipei City to Los Angeles departing in May.

What is the cheapest Taipei City to Los Angeles flight route?

Data is based on round-trip flight searches on KAYAK over the past month.

The cheapest return flight from Taipei City to Los Angeles costs $788 on the route between Taipei City Taiwan Taoyuan Intl Airport (TPE) and Los Angeles (LAX). It is also the most popular route.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Taipei City to Los Angeles?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Taipei City to Los Angeles cl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

Your flight ticket price will generally be cheaper if you fly to Los Angeles on a Monday and more expensive on a Saturday. On your return trip to Taipei City, you should consider flying back on a Tuesday, and avoid Saturdays for better de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Taipei City to Los Angeles?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Taipei City to Los Angeles,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Taipei City to Los Angeles is November, where tickets cost $676 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and July,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,142 and $1,129 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Taipei City to Los Angeles?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Taipei City to Los Angeles,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Taipei City to Los Angeles, you should book around 5 weeks before departure, which saves you about 19%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 19 weeks before departure.

One thing to be mindful of is that China Airlines has a carryon luggage weight restriction of 7kg. While it was somewhat enforced on my flight from LAX to TPE and I was forced to remove my laptop and other heavier items from my carryon, it was not enforced on my return flight making it very inconsistent. I do not have to deal a carryon restriction on my other international flights so this was an inconvience flying China Arilines vs other Asian airlines like EVA Air and Asiana.
